I have the GP Pitts Special with the Fuji-50SB and have been experimenting with different props. The first prop was the APC 20x10 ... flies fast with good verticle, but is fast on approaches and landings and makes the plane a little nose heavy. Tried a wood prop(less than half the weight of the APC)Zinger Pro 22x10 ...pulls it good and slows down nicely on approaches and landings, with the CofG right on!! The only thing is, at full throttle the engine sags a little and the verticle is compromised. I like the way the Zinger pulls and slows the Pitts, but would like a little more verticle.

Have any of you guys cut a prop down? Do you think this would help a little?(more RPM)

I've noticed that most Prop Manufactures go from size 20 to 22. I'm thinking a 21 size(cutting the Zinger down to) will help the performance.

What do you guys think?
